Table Tennis: A Significant Victory for North East Players in Vadodara's WTT Feeder Series
The recent WTT Feeder Series 2026 held in Vadodara, Gujarat, witnessed an exciting conclusion with Manush Shah and Ryu Hanna clinching the men's and women's singles titles, respectively. This event, hosted by Table Tennis Association of Baroda and implemented by UTT, marked the inaugural edition of the WTT Feeder Series in Vadodara.
Local Favourite Manush Shah's Comeback Victory
Top seed and local favourite Manush Shah faced a challenging final against Payas Jain. Initially, Manush found himself trailing 0-2, losing the first two games. However, he managed to regain his composure and displayed an impressive comeback, winning the next three games and the match 7-11, 10-12, 11-6, 11-6, 11-8.
Ryu Hanna's Dominant Performance
In the women's singles final, Ryu Hanna demonstrated a dominant performance against qualifier Anusha, winning the match 3-0 (11-6, 11-6, 11-5).
